Understanding Pool Result Classifications
To correctly interpret the Week 31 Pool Result 2026, it is essential to understand the official result classifications used across UK football pools.
A Home result indicates the home team won the match at full time.
An Away result indicates the visiting team won at full time.
A Score Draw means both teams scored goals and the match ended level.
A No Score Draw means the match ended goalless.
These classifications are standardized across UK pool operators and are critical for ensuring uniform interpretation of pool results across different platforms.

Pools Panel Decisions and Their Impact
Not all matches are decided strictly by on-field results. In Week 31, as in other pool weeks, some fixtures may require Pools Panel intervention. This occurs when matches are postponed, abandoned, or otherwise disrupted.
Pools Panel decisions follow predefined rules to determine whether a match is declared:
- Home win
- Away win
- Score Draw
These decisions are documented alongside standard results, ensuring that pool result for this week records remain complete and auditable.
